DTE Energy Company (NYSE:DTE) to Issue Quarterly Dividend of $1.17

DTE Energy Company (NYSE:DTEGet Free Report) announced a quarterly dividend on Thursday, May 7th. Stockholders of record on Monday, June 22nd will be given a dividend of 1.165 per share by the utilities provider on Wednesday, July 15th. This represents a c) d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 3.3%. The ex-dividend date is Monday, June 22nd.

DTE Energy has increased its dividend payment by an average of 0.0%per year over the last three years and has raised its dividend every year for the last 16 years. DTE Energy has a payout ratio of 60.2% indicating that its dividend is sufficiently covered by earnings. Analysts expect DTE Energy to earn $8.33 per share next year, which means the company should continue to be able to cover its $4.66 annual dividend with an expected future payout ratio of 55.9%.

About DTE Energy

DTE Energy is an integrated energy company headquartered in Detroit, Michigan, that combines regulated utility operations with non-utility energy businesses. Its regulated subsidiaries operate electric and natural gas utility services that deliver generation, transmission and distribution to residential, commercial and industrial customers. The company’s utility segment focuses on maintaining and upgrading energy delivery infrastructure, ensuring reliable service and meeting regulatory requirements in its service territory.

Beyond its regulated utilities, DTE Energy operates non-utility businesses that develop, own and operate power generation and energy-related projects.
